[user] name = Santo Cariotti email = santo@dcariotti.me signingkey = C9B7C8FD3701C2C6 [alias] amend = commit --amend --verbose ci = commit --verbose co = checkout cp = cherry-pick di = diff dis = diff --staged fd = "!f() { git log --grep=$1; }; f" logs = log --graph --branches --remotes --tags --pretty=format':%C(yellow)%h%C(green)%d%Creset %C(cyan)%an <%ae> %Creset%C(white)%aD %C(red)(%ar)\n%s%Creset\n' st = status [credential] helper = store [core] editor = nvim ; pager = bat -n --style=plain ; pager = delta excludesFile = ~/.gitignore [init] defaultBranch = main [grep] lineNumber = true [color "grep"] lineNumber = yellow match = red bold filename = cyan [merge] tool = nvimdiff conflictstyle = diff3 [mergetool] prompt = false ; [interactive] ; diffFilter = delta --color-only ; [delta] ; features = line-numbers decorations [pull] rebase = false [diff] ; external = difft algorithm = histogram [safe] directory = /home/santo/Documents/Notes [url "git@github.com:"] pushInsteadOf = "https://github.com/" pushInsteadOf = "github:" pushInsteadOf = "git://github.com/"